Output 07a6d82c8a74b625d18534a1de8e01b3489527cddffd17d77a0e62a7f8d518b5:0

value
595733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f62dba30a68d17dea24c8eb757960f4baf5f42f3 OP_EQUAL
address
3Q8gvvUpCDcNbJKwbJS3iFPA8VKvAM9t6J
transaction
07a6d82c8a74b625d18534a1de8e01b3489527cddffd17d77a0e62a7f8d518b5
confirmations
321644
spent
true